Embodiment 1

[0030] refer to figure 1 , shows a flow chart of steps of a method for logging in an email account in Embodiment 1 of the present invention. In this embodiment, the login method of the email account includes:

[0031] Step 102, receiving a first trigger operation request for an email account in an email client.

[0032] In this embodiment, the mail client refers to software that uses IMAP, APOP, POP3, SMTP, or ESMTP protocols to send and receive emails. Users do not need to log in to the web mailbox page through a browser to send and receive emails. Among them, the commonly used protocols for receiving emails are POP3 and IMAP, and the commonly used protocols for sending emails are SMTP. In addition, the mail client implements sending and receiving of attachments of emails through MIME (Multipurpose Internet Mail Extensions, Multipurpose Internet Mail Extensions). Abstract

The invention discloses a mail account log-in method and a mail client side. The method comprises the steps that a first trigger operation request for a mail account in the mail client side is received; a label page is built in the mail client side according to the first trigger operation request; configuration information of the mail account is obtained, wherein the configuration information comprises mail server information and the account name and passwords of the mail account; a page loading request is sent to a mail server determined according to the mail server information; a log-in page is loaded and displayed in the newly-built label page according to response information, responding to the page loading request, returned by the mail server; the account name and the passwords of the mail account are automatically added to the set positions of the log-in page, so that login of the mail account on the web page is achieved. The mail account log-in method solves the problems that the mail client side is poor in interaction, and information is hard to share.

Description

technical field [0001] The invention relates to the technical field of communications, in particular to a method for logging in an email account and an email client. Background technique [0002] With the rapid development of the communication field, there are more and more various communication tools. In addition to the commonly used instant messaging tools, more and more users start to use emails for communication. [0003] At present, users usually use a mail client (eg, Outlook and Mozilla Thunderbird and other mail clients included in the Windows system) to manage emails and perform sending and receiving operations. However, the currently commonly used mail clients are relatively independent, and the interaction between the client and the client, and between the client and other applications (such as browsers) is poor, information is difficult to share, and frequent switching operations are required to realize the mail account login.
